Records, 1948-1970.

Correspondence, reports, brochures, newsletters, scrapbooks, programs, photos, calendars, and other records, relating to the internal affairs and activities of the club, and its affiliation with American Home Economics Association and Illinois Home Economics Association.

1.1 linear ft.

Illinois Home Economics Association

http://n2t.net/ark:/99166/w6wb1m3h (corporateBody)

The Illinois Home Economics Association was founded in 1921 as a state affiliate to the American Home Economics Association. In 1994, both groups changed their names: the national organization became the American Association of Family and Consumer Sciences and the state organization became the Illinois Association of Family and Consumer Sciences.
